From a technical point of view, a gas convector is a fairly simple device. Accordingly, its installation may seem a simple matter. However, there are a number of rules and nuances, the neglect of which can lead to incorrect operation of the device or even to an accident. Consider the basic rules for installing a gas convector

Installation of a gas convector is regulated by the following documents: DBN V.2.5-20-2001 "Gas supply"; DNAOP 0.00-1.20-98 "Rules for the safety of gas supply systems in Ukraine"; NAPB A. 01.001-2004 "Rules of fire safety in Ukraine".

Mounting the gas convector on the wall

The installation of the convector should be carried out in the place of the greatest heat loss in the room, ideally under the window. But here one important nuance arises: there should not be flammable objects and structures near the device. It is strictly forbidden to hang it with curtains, curtains, etc., since the body of the device heats up significantly during operation.

Included with the convector, some manufacturers include wiring diagram(template), which shows the places for fixing the device to the wall and the exit point coaxial chimney. When choosing a mounting location, it is important to ensure that the distance along the outer wall between the coaxial chimney and the ground level is at least 0.5 m, and from the nearest window - at least 0.25 m. It is also necessary to take into account the possibility of snow drift, which can block the outlet combustion products. Indoors, the device must be installed in such a way that the distance between the lowest part of the convector (usually the rear wall) and the floor is at least 0.10 m; for the best quality convection, this distance should be 0.20-0.25 m. The distance between the device and the side wall should be at least 0.18 m. 10 m (Fig. 1).

coaxial chimney

Installation of a coaxial chimney is carried out in a pre-punched (drilled) hole in the wall. Here problems of a purely technical nature may arise, because the removal of combustion products and the intake of combustion air in gas convectors occur naturally, and therefore the outer diameter of the chimney is large enough. Basically, the diameter of the hole in the wall, depending on the requirements of the manufacturer, should be 0.16-0.20 m. daunting task if the wall is made of durable material.

The length of the coaxial chimney in most models is a maximum of 0.59 m, i.e. the thickness of the wall on which the device is installed should not exceed this value. The minimum wall thickness may be less than 0.20 m, but the manufacturer does not guarantee normal the operation of the convector and the achievement of the parameters specified in the technical data sheet, due to the large heat losses of the building. The chimney must be mounted in such a way that the air intake pipe is located flush with the plane outer wall and protruded 0.035 m into the room. In addition, in order to avoid moisture entering the apparatus, the slope of the coaxial chimney by 2-3 degrees should be taken into account. Outside, a protective cap is attached to the chimney, which, firstly, prevents the ingress of foreign objects, secondly, it serves as protection against wind blowing and knocking down the burner flame.

Gas convector installation errors

  • a coaxial chimney protrudes from the wall (fig. 2). This installation option leads to frequent shutdown of the device due to the increased likelihood of wind blowing. V winter period in severe frosts, the combustion products will be strongly cooled, which will lead to the formation and subsequent freezing of condensate inside the chimney;
  • the coaxial chimney is not installed tightly. The consequences may be frequent malfunctions of the device;
  • incorrect slope of the chimney. In addition to incorrect operation of the device, this leads to moisture ingress and, as a result, to corrosion and destruction of the heat exchanger;
  • narrowing the diameter of the gas supply. For stable operation of the convector, gas must be connected by a pipe, the diameter of which is indicated in the passport. Reducing this size can lead to the loss of the pilot burner flame, non-ignition of the main burner, spontaneous shutdown of the convector, and a decrease in power.

It is important that the gas convector be mounted on a non-combustible surface in accordance with DBN standards (insulation with roofing steel over asbestos sheet at least 3 mm thick, plaster, etc.) at a distance of at least 30 mm from the wall. The insulation must protrude beyond the dimensions of the enclosure. Violation of these standards may lead to damage to the material of the walls or
even to the fire.

Device device and principle of operation

Let's start with the definition of a gas convector. This heater is not an analogue of a gas boiler. It works on a completely different principle - it does not heat the coolant, but the air. installed in relatively small rooms, as they heat the air locally.

The design of this heater is relatively simple. The gas convector consists of the following parts:

  • heat exchanger in which air is heated;
  • programmer- a device responsible for maintaining a certain temperature in the room;
  • control panel, on which the indicators are displayed;
  • gas valve, controlling the gas supply;
  • fan #1 responsible for supplying air to the heat exchanger and valve;
  • fan number 2, dispersing the heated air around the room.

How does a gas convector work? Everything is quite simple: it functions on the principle gas burner. Cold air from the outside, obeying the laws of physics, enters from below, heats up and exits through the hole at the top of the device. Note that gas models can function due to natural or forced convection. In the second case, air is blown by fan No. 1.

Requirements for the premises

Requirements of gas services for premises:

  1. Ceilings should be at least two and a half meters, which is important, because many wooden houses built with low ceilings, and this is with the most low-power equipment;
  2. The ventilation channel must be equal to or greater than 100 mm in diameter, the material from which it is made must comply with SNIP, and the lower part ventilation duct must be at least 200 mm below the ceiling;
  3. The bottom gaps interior doors must be at least 25 mm;
  4. Each room should have windows that allow ventilation;
  5. The boiler room must be equipped with a door to the adjacent non-residential premises, and when installing a boiler with a power of over 150 kW, a separate entrance door;
  6. The internal space of the boiler room must be at least 7.5 m3 in volume, for new houses this requirement has been doubled;
  7. Chimney - must be equipped with two walls, its diameter must exceed or be equal to the inlet pipe of the equipment;
  8. Lighting in the boiler room must be safe; for this, open light bulbs without shades are not allowed;
  9. In the case of external wiring, it must be placed in specialized cable channels;
  10. The indoor gas control system must be installed in a wooden house if the boiler is located in the basement.

Installation of a gas stove and convectors

It is forbidden to install the convector at a distance of less than 4 meters from open sources of fire, including gas stove. The hose suitable for the convector must have a dielectric insert, this will prevent a fire in the event of a short circuit in the wiring in a wooden house.

An important factor is the grounding of sockets located near the gas stove and convectors, although in a wooden house they must be grounded a priori.

There are three types of supply hoses that are allowed to a gas stove in a wooden house, namely:

  • Rubber fabric - its plus is that it does not conduct electric current, but it is more susceptible to mechanical damage compared to analogues;
  • Metal sleeve - when using it, a dielectric insert is necessarily inserted from the gas stove to the main, and otherwise it has the best performance among analogues. In addition, it is recommended by the latest approved standards. Its only disadvantage is the price, it bites;
  • Rubber with a metal braid - it is more able to withstand severe shocks, and also, thanks to the rubber core, does not conduct current.

When buying a hose, pay attention to the colors, on its sheath there are characteristic yellow colors used only for marking gas equipment.

When buying a metal hose, you should pay attention to its coating, some manufacturers oriented to other markets, with other standards, use yellow insulation, which does not fulfill its main functions. Always ask for supporting documents when purchasing, and keep them in a safe place.

The process of installing a gas convector in a wooden house

There is nothing easier than fixing the converter to wooden wall, for this you will need:

  • self-tapping screws;
  • Crosshead screwdriver;
  • Mounts (comes with the converter);
  • Building level;
  • Pencil.

First you need to check how far apart the loops are, for which the gas convector is hung. Most often, they are wide enough, which allows you to move it to the left and right already on the mounts, at a distance of about 5 cm.

Measure the distance between the centers of the seats, for the upper and lower loops it will be the same. Transfer these dimensions to the wall, observing the height you need from the floor, most often it ranges from 10 to 20 cm.

The self-tapping screws used must be at least 40 mm long, this will ensure a secure fixation to the wall in a wooden house.

Screw on the screws at the indicated points, and double-check with the help of the convector whether the distances match by bringing it to the heads of the screws. If so, then you can safely fix the hooks to the wooden wall.

When the fasteners are screwed, put a level on them and check the slope relative to the horizon, it can be leveled by loosening one of the fasteners and slightly raising it. Now you can hang the gas convector on a wooden wall.

Gas supply to the convector

Close the gas valve in front of the meter.

This process requires special attention in any room, and even more so when it comes to a wooden house. The main thing here is to check whether all the gas supply elements correspond to the description of the accompanying documentation.

Ball valves with a yellow marking on the handle are screwed onto the convector. Before starting, they must be in the closed state. It is necessary to fasten a hose or sleeve to the gas cylinder or line, be sure to check for the presence of a paranitic gasket in the union nut of the hose.

The next step is to connect the other end of the hose to the tap installed on the gas convector. Here you should also check if there is a gasket. After you need to compress all connections with ring wrenches.

Calculate the force, it is important not to transfer the gaskets, otherwise the gas will pass through the damaged parts of the system.

Now you can open the gas and taps on the convector. Using a shaving brush, apply the lather solution to all joints. After making sure that there are no leaks, you can proceed to the first start-up.

The first start-up in a wooden house is made with windows open for ventilation.

We start the gas convector

Immediately before starting, we open the gas valve and go through all the joints, fittings and threaded connections with a brush moistened with a small solution. Dishwashing liquid is excellent for this purpose. If you see bubbles rising, turn off the faucet immediately and fix the leak. I forgot to say - at this moment it is better not to smoke.

After repacking the joints, start the convector. To do this, press the gas supply button and do not release it for about a minute so that the gas fills the pipes and enters the combustion chamber.

Now press the piezo ignition button. A spark will ignite the gas and a blue, cheerful blue flame will ignite in the combustion chamber. In case you did everything right :).

Adjust the operation of the convector to obtain a comfortable temperature.

At first, for about a few hours of operation, the presence of an unpleasant smell of burnt oil is allowed. It's not scary - the convector is new - the combustion chamber is warming up and burning. However, if the smell does not disappear for a long time, you need to turn off the gas and carefully examine the junction of the outlet of the convector and the exhaust pipe.
